Johns Island Travel Guide

Indian River Shores


Popular places to visit


Top hotels in Johns Island

Kimpton Vero Beach Hotel & Spa by IHG
Kimpton Vero Beach Hotel & Spa by IHG
4 out of 5
3500 Ocean Dr, Vero Beach, FL
The price is ₹19,082 per night from 10 Aug to 11 Aug
₹19,082
per night
10 Aug - 11 Aug
Stay at this 4-star beach hotel in Vero Beach. Enjoy a full-service spa, 2 restaurants and a beach locale. Our guests praise the helpful staff in their reviews. ...
9.2/10 Wonderful! (1,002 reviews)
"Great location to relax and enjoy the ocean"

Reviewed on 10 Jul 2025

Kimpton Vero Beach Hotel & Spa by IHG
Costa d'Este Beach Resort and Spa
Costa d'Este Beach Resort and Spa
4 out of 5
3244 Ocean Drive, Vero Beach, FL
The price is ₹19,987 per night from 28 Jul to 29 Jul
₹19,987
per night
28 Jul - 29 Jul
Stay at this 4-star beach hotel in Vero Beach. Enjoy a full-service spa, a beach locale and 2 bars/lounges. Our guests praise the restaurant and the helpful ...
9/10 Wonderful! (1,005 reviews)
"It is near the beach."

Reviewed on 10 Jul 2025

Costa d'Este Beach Resort and Spa
Hutchinson Island Hotel
Hutchinson Island Hotel
2.5 out of 5
1230 Seaway Drive, Hutchinson Island, Fort Pierce, FL
The price is ₹10,495 per night from 4 Aug to 5 Aug
₹10,495
per night
4 Aug - 5 Aug
Stay at this beach hotel in Fort Pierce.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the pool and the helpful staff in their reviews. ...
8.4/10 Very Good! (1,439 reviews)
"The property was clean and our room was clean and ready upon arrival. Will definitely stay here again!"

Reviewed on 13 Jul 2025

Hutchinson Island Hotel
Ocean Breeze Inn Vero Beach
Ocean Breeze Inn Vero Beach
3.5 out of 5
3384 Ocean Dr, Vero Beach, FL
The price is ₹10,194 per night from 3 Aug to 4 Aug
₹10,194
per night
3 Aug - 4 Aug
Stay at this 3.5-star beach hotel in Vero Beach. Enjoy free Wi-Fi, free parking and a private beach. Our guests praise the pool and the helpful staff in their ...
8.4/10 Very Good! (1,010 reviews)
"Great little town with plenty of restaurants and shops. Hotel was a buy out from Days Inn, so it does need an upgrade not only throughout the premises but the rooms. Toiletry very humble. Bring your own. To compensate all that the employees are great. Very attentive to your needs, very polite. Overall ..."

Reviewed on 7 Jul 2025

Ocean Breeze Inn Vero Beach
Vero Beach Inn & Suites I-95
Vero Beach Inn & Suites I-95
3 out of 5
8797 20th St, Vero Beach, FL
Stay at this 3-star business-friendly hotel in Vero Beach.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the breakfast and the helpful ...
8.2/10 Very Good! (1,163 reviews)
Great stay
"This is the 2nd time in a month we have stayed at this location due to sickness and then the death of my stepson. We have no problems at all with this hotel. Everyone on staff is very friendly and helpful. We could not get the tv to work the first night. The desk clerk kindly came and explained how ..."

Reviewed on 9 Jul 2025

Vero Beach Inn & Suites I-95
Hampton Inn Vero Beach
Hampton Inn Vero Beach
2.5 out of 5
9350 19th Ln, Vero Beach, FL
The price is ₹9,189 per night from 20 Jul to 21 Jul
₹9,189
per night
20 Jul - 21 Jul
Stay at this business-friendly hotel in Vero Beach.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the breakfast and the helpful staff ...
8.6/10 Excellent! (1,000 reviews)
"Great place easy on off. Pet friendly!"

Reviewed on 9 Jul 2025

Hampton Inn Vero Beach
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Johns Island Travel Guide